This June 2, 2022, Queen Elizabeth II was honored on the occasion of her platinum jubilee celebrating her 70 years of reign. A historic event followed by millions of viewers around the world. On the spot, the lucky British or foreigners were able to see several members of the British royal family during the impressive procession which advanced to Buckingham Palace.

On the balcony of the famous building, the sovereign, who was eagerly awaited, attracted all eyes before being upstaged by her great-grandson, the young Prince Louis, aged 4. It must be said that the children of Kate Middleton and Prince William are at the heart of all attention during their official outings. Prince George of Cambridge, 8, and his sister, Princess Charlotte, 7, admired the incredible crowd present for the Jubilee. The youngest of the siblings, Louis of Cambridge, who looks just like his eldest, was filmed grimacing, shouting or even plugging his ears. An astonishing sequence as he took his place alongside the sovereign.

Queen Elizabeth II, 96, was also quite complicit with him, exchanging a few words with the child. As a reminder, the boy is placed fifth in the order of succession to the British throne behind his grandfather Prince Charles then his father Prince William and his brother, Prince George.
